automatic logon to linux machine
Hi All,
Can anyone please tell me the settings that i need to do for logging into linux machine automatically as root user. I tried to search in net but I could not find any information about settings to logon as root user however I was able to find for other users.

Hi and Welcome !
It is not recommended to log in as root user and setting up autologin for root user could be real disaster. I would suggest not to do this and use su for gaining root privileges while logging in as Regular User.It is amazing what you can accomplish if you do not care who gets the credit.
